About North Hills, NY's

North Hills is a village located in Nassau County, New York, primarily known for its affluent residential character and meticulously maintained landscapes. Established in 1929, North Hills is nestled in the heart of Long Island, offering a serene and upscale living environment. The village's strategic location near major highways such as the Long Island Expressway provides residents with easy access to New York City and other parts of Long Island.

The Economy of North Hills, NY

The economy of North Hills is predominantly driven by the residential sector, with a focus on high-end real estate. The village's economic landscape is characterized by luxury housing developments and the presence of several corporate headquarters in the vicinity, contributing to its local economy. Retail and professional services also play a role, catering to the affluent population.

Understanding the BLS and Inflation in North Hills, NY

The Bureau of Labor Statistics (BLS) is a government agency that collects and analyzes economic data across the U.S., including cities like North Hills, NY. One of its key responsibilities is tracking inflation through the Consumer Price Index (CPI), which measures how the cost of everyday goods and services changes over time. Inflation can impact everything from housing prices to the cost of groceries, gas, and utilities across the area. By tracking inflation, the BLS helps people from North Hills, NY understand how their purchasing power is affected and provides insights for businesses and policymakers.
